Mastodon is more of a protocol than a single service. It succeeds/fails on those terms, in the same way the old Web1.0 protocols did. Which is to say, you can’t enshitify a thousand micro-sites at once like you can enshittify one big site that’s under central control. But you also can’t do things like navigate, search, and socialize efficiently.
Mastodon is successful in large part because it isn’t. When you let a single cartel of corporate psychos run a Mastodon account like they would a Twitter or Facebook, you end up with Truth Social (literally just a Mastodon branch instance).
That’s an interesting perspective. Do you think the same about lemmy? While also decentralized using the sameprotocol, it seems reasonably efficient to me. I’m from a small instance from my country, and the global content is easily available to me.
I just have a lot of trouble explaining how it works to people who aren’t tech savy… this is what I consider the main issue withthe fediverse as a whole.
I think it depends on how the federated sites are administered going forward. We’ve already seen bigger sites - like Threads, for instance - try to integrate into the overall ecosystem. And I could see a future in which one of the larger instances - a .world or .sh.itjust.works - is too much for a handful of amateur admins to handle. Hand off the instance to a venture capital firm and you could see rapid enshitification.
I just have a lot of trouble explaining how it works to people who aren’t tech savy…
I’m reasonably tech savvy and even I’d struggle to tell you exactly how it works. How is .world hosted? Is it load-balanced or otherwise optimized? Who controls registration and which other instances does it integrate with? How do you find a list of active instances to federate against? Who do you even talk to in order to federate with another instance? What does the API look like and which instances allow you to crawl them? How do bots integrate with the environment and what can an admin do to limit them? No idea.
There’s a bunch of things I think I should be able to do but I can’t. For instance, signing into .world but only surfing content that’s hosted on .sh.itjust.works.
There’s also a lot of petty politics. Admins deciding on a whim who to block, whether it be individuals or whole instances. Waking up one day and suddenly not having access to a dozen of my favorite subs, because two admins are feuding, is not particularly fun. I never have a problem like that on BlueSky or Instagram.
Mastodon is more of a protocol than a single service. It succeeds/fails on those terms, in the same way the old Web1.0 protocols did. Which is to say, you can’t enshitify a thousand micro-sites at once like you can enshittify one big site that’s under central control. But you also can’t do things like navigate, search, and socialize efficiently.
Mastodon is successful in large part because it isn’t. When you let a single cartel of corporate psychos run a Mastodon account like they would a Twitter or Facebook, you end up with Truth Social (literally just a Mastodon branch instance).
ActivityPub is the protocol though. Mastodon is an implementation of the protocol.
That’s an interesting perspective. Do you think the same about lemmy? While also decentralized using the sameprotocol, it seems reasonably efficient to me. I’m from a small instance from my country, and the global content is easily available to me.
I just have a lot of trouble explaining how it works to people who aren’t tech savy… this is what I consider the main issue withthe fediverse as a whole.
I think it depends on how the federated sites are administered going forward. We’ve already seen bigger sites - like Threads, for instance - try to integrate into the overall ecosystem. And I could see a future in which one of the larger instances - a .world or .sh.itjust.works - is too much for a handful of amateur admins to handle. Hand off the instance to a venture capital firm and you could see rapid enshitification.
I’m reasonably tech savvy and even I’d struggle to tell you exactly how it works. How is .world hosted? Is it load-balanced or otherwise optimized? Who controls registration and which other instances does it integrate with? How do you find a list of active instances to federate against? Who do you even talk to in order to federate with another instance? What does the API look like and which instances allow you to crawl them? How do bots integrate with the environment and what can an admin do to limit them? No idea.
There’s a bunch of things I think I should be able to do but I can’t. For instance, signing into .world but only surfing content that’s hosted on .sh.itjust.works.
There’s also a lot of petty politics. Admins deciding on a whim who to block, whether it be individuals or whole instances. Waking up one day and suddenly not having access to a dozen of my favorite subs, because two admins are feuding, is not particularly fun. I never have a problem like that on BlueSky or Instagram.
People complain that the mainstream sites are relatively closed ecosystems, but they also complain when those sites try to be more open ¯\_(ツ)_/¯
People don’t like the monolith when it’s over there and they don’t like it when it comes over here, either